The temperature ranged from 16.6°C around 22:00 to 25.4°C around 12:00. No measurable rain was recorded during the day.

Source
ERA5 reanalysis, accessed via the Copernicus Climate Change Service (C3S) Climate Data Store
Data type
Reanalysis — a physically consistent reconstruction combining a forecast model with historical observations, not a live station reading or a forecast
